Precision Power
Power Class Amplifiers

The Precision Power line of Power Class amplifiers clearly represents what audiophile quality car audio should be. Unparalleled sound quality stems from multiple factors; top quality torroidial transformers, all N-channel transistors, extremely low tolerance resistors and capacitors. Power Class preamp sections are extremely detailed with 4 different types of crossovers: high pass, low pass, band pass, and subsonic. To ensure the amplifier’s output is not ruined by cheap or noisy input signals, we included balanced line inputs to be used with our BLT transmitters for the ultimate listening experience.

Orion
HCCA-25001

The Orion HCCA-25001 is a high current competition Class D Mono (5,000 Watts Peak) amplifier. The Orion HCCA-25001 features MOSFET power supplies and output stages, patented ESP, heavy gauge / high current angle lock power and speaker terminals, plus IntelliQ bass optimization circuit and remote gain control. This amplifier also offers low level and high level balanced input, infrasonic filter, a remote gain controller and concealed controls under its locking top panel.
